Intel Core i3-10320 vs Intel Core i3-10100 vs Intel Core i3-10100F

The Intel Core i3-10320 is an entry level quad-core desktop processor based on the Comet Lake-S architecture (CML-S, 4th generation of Skylake). The processor clocks at between 3.8 and 4.6 GHz and can execute up to eight threads with its four cores simultaneously thanks to Hyper-Threading. 

The processor is still manufactured in the old 14nm (14nm++) process. Thanks to the free multiplicator, the CPU can also be easily overclocked (but may not have much headroom).

The Comet Lake architecture is similar to Coffee Lake and offers the same features and is produced in the same 14nm process. Other than the improved clock rates, the memory controller now also supports faster DDR4-2933 RAM. More information on Comet Lake and all the models and articles on it can be found here.

Performance

The performance is similar to the old high end Intel Core i7-7700K due to the same architecture and similar clock speeds. 

Graphics

The integrated Intel UHD Graphics 630 iGPU is supposed to offer a similar performance as the UHD630 in the Core i7-9900K. As a  low-end solution it will only run current games smoothly at reduced details - if at all.

Power Consumption

Intel specifies the TDP with 65 Watts (PL1) but under full load up to 90 Watt are consumed (PL2 for 28s).

The Intel Core i3-10100 is a four-core desktop processor based on the Comet Lake S architecture. The processor clocks at 3.6 - 4.3 GHz and can process up to 8 threads simultaneously. The Intel Core i3-10100 is manufactured in the improved 14nm process (14nm++). Compared to the older i3-9100 (Comet Lake-S), the 10100 offers a 100 MHz higher turbo clock, multithreading and support for faster DDR4-2666 memory.

Performance

The performance should be only slightly above the Core i3-9100 in the entry level for desktop CPUs. Thus the performance is sufficient for office and undemanding gaming.

Graphics Card

The Intel Core i3-10100 is a processor with a rather slow entry level integrated graphics unit (Intel UHD Graphics 630). 

Power consumption

Intel puts the Thermal Design Power (TDP) at 65 watts. This means there is no need for large cooling systems, which also allows installation in very compact housings.

The Intel Core i3-10100F is an entry level quad-core processor for desktop PCs based on the Comet Lake-S architecture. It offers four cores clocked at 3.6 - 4.3 GHz with HyperThreading / SMT support (8 threads). The CPU is still manufactured on 14nm++ and does not feature an integrated graphics card. Compared to the older Coffee Lake Core i3-9100F, the i3-10100F offers a 100 MHz higher Boost speed, HyperThreading and support for faster DDR4 memory (2666 MHz).

Performance

While we have not tested a single system powered by the 10100F as of August 2023, it's reasonable to expect the chip to be just slightly faster than the Core i5-10200H.

Intel specifies the CPU with a TDP of 65 Watt. For desktops that means that the processor won't need big cooling solutions and can be used in small cases.
